Output ef6204edcee90692d8dcd286f79ab5e82602100d07e1453b10225b225a1f434a:14

value
58601292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e68fa9f91169c6ad280f03de7f3097f7487d229d OP_EQUAL
address
MUvFkVqAb38rqNNoTZ6aTNLr3CQpDZxwrP
transaction
ef6204edcee90692d8dcd286f79ab5e82602100d07e1453b10225b225a1f434a
spent
true